What are Cricut Tree Templates?

Let's start with the basics. Cricut tree templates are pre-designed digital files that you can use with your Cricut cutting machine. These templates come in various formats, such as SVG (Scalable Vector Graphics), which are perfect for resizing without losing quality. Think of them as your blueprints for creating stunning tree-shaped designs. You can find templates for all sorts of trees, from classic Christmas trees and whimsical paper trees to intricate family trees and abstract arboreal designs. The possibilities are truly endless!

These templates take the guesswork out of creating complex tree shapes. Instead of spending hours trying to draw perfect branches and leaves, you can simply upload a template into Cricut Design Space, adjust the size and material settings, and let your machine do the cutting. This saves you valuable time and ensures consistent, professional-looking results. Plus, the vast library of available templates means you'll never run out of inspiration for your next project.

Finding the Perfect Cricut Tree Template

Okay, you're sold on the idea of using Cricut tree templates. Awesome! Now, where do you find them? Luckily, there are tons of resources available:

  • Cricut Design Space: Cricut's own design software, Design Space, has a massive library of images and templates, including a wide selection of tree designs. Many of these are free with a Cricut Access subscription, while others can be purchased individually. Design Space is a great place to start your search, as it seamlessly integrates with your Cricut machine.
  • Etsy: Etsy is a treasure trove of digital designs created by independent artists. You'll find a vast array of Cricut tree templates here, ranging from simple silhouettes to complex 3D models. Etsy is a fantastic option if you're looking for unique and original designs.
  • Other Online Marketplaces: Websites like Creative Fabrica, Design Bundles, and So Fontsy also offer a wide selection of Cricut templates, often at very competitive prices. These marketplaces frequently have sales and bundles, so you can snag some amazing deals.
  • Free Template Websites: If you're on a budget, there are several websites that offer free Cricut templates. Sites like LoveSVG, FreeSVG.org, and The SVG Attic have a variety of tree designs available for download. Just be sure to check the licensing terms before using any free template, especially if you plan to sell your creations.

When searching for templates, consider the following:

  • File Format: Make sure the template is in a compatible format for Cricut Design Space, such as SVG, PNG, or JPG. SVG is the preferred format, as it's scalable and retains its quality when resized.
  • Complexity: Think about your skill level and the time you're willing to invest. Intricate templates can create stunning results, but they may also require more time and patience to cut and assemble. Start with simpler designs if you're a beginner.
  • Project Type: Consider the project you have in mind. A simple silhouette might be perfect for a card, while a 3D template would be better for an ornament or centerpiece.
  • Reviews and Ratings: If you're purchasing a template from an online marketplace, check the reviews and ratings. This can give you valuable insights into the quality of the design and the seller's customer service.

Mastering the Art of Using Cricut Tree Templates

Alright, you've found the perfect Cricut tree template – now it's time to put it to use! Here's a step-by-step guide to help you master the art of crafting with templates:

  1. Upload the Template to Cricut Design Space: Open Cricut Design Space and click the “Upload” button. Select the template file from your computer and follow the prompts to upload it into Design Space. You may need to resize the template to your desired dimensions.
  2. Prepare Your Materials: Choose the material you want to use for your project, such as cardstock, vinyl, or felt. Gather your tools, including your Cricut machine, cutting mat, weeding tools, and any embellishments you want to add.
  3. Adjust the Cut Settings: In Cricut Design Space, select the appropriate material setting for your chosen material. This is crucial for ensuring a clean and accurate cut. You may need to do a test cut to fine-tune the settings.
  4. Load the Mat and Cut: Place your material onto the cutting mat, ensuring it's securely adhered. Load the mat into your Cricut machine and press the “Go” button. The machine will now cut out the tree template.
  5. Weed the Excess Material: Once the cutting is complete, remove the mat from the machine. Use your weeding tools to carefully remove the excess material around the tree design. This can be a bit time-consuming for intricate designs, so be patient!
  6. Assemble and Embellish: Now comes the fun part – assembling your tree and adding embellishments! If you're working with a multi-layered design, carefully glue or tape the pieces together. Add glitter, paint, beads, or any other embellishments to personalize your creation. Let your imagination run wild!

Tips and Tricks for Success

Before we wrap up, here are a few extra tips and tricks to help you achieve crafting success with Cricut tree templates:

  • Use the Right Materials: Choosing the right materials is crucial for achieving the best results. Cardstock is ideal for paper crafts, while vinyl is perfect for decals and adhesive projects. Felt is a great option for ornaments and soft crafts.
  • Test Cut Your Materials: Always do a test cut before cutting your final design. This will help you ensure that your material settings are correct and that your Cricut machine is cutting properly.
  • Use Sharp Blades: Dull blades can lead to ragged edges and inaccurate cuts. Replace your blades regularly to maintain optimal cutting performance.
  • Weed Carefully: Weeding intricate designs can be tricky. Take your time and use sharp weeding tools to avoid tearing or damaging your design.
